Aspects Impacting Door Rates
When taking into consideration garage door replacement, house owners have to navigate a selection of variables that substantially affect door rates. Among the primary factors is the product of the door. Alternatives vary from traditional wood to sturdy steel, each with unique costs and upkeep demands. Wood doors, while aesthetically pleasing, frequently demand greater prices because of their all-natural high qualities and the need for routine refinishing. Conversely, steel doors are generally a lot more cost effective and deal enhanced safety and insulation.
Another essential variable is the door style. Criterion raised-panel layouts usually cost less than personalized or contemporary designs, which can elevate aesthetic appeals yet also the price. Additionally, the dimension of the garage door effects expenses; larger doors need even more product and possibly much more complicated mechanisms.
Insulation is one more factor to consider, as protected doors have a tendency to be costlier yet offer energy-saving advantages, specifically in regions with severe climates. Last but not least, the brand and manufacturer can likewise affect pricing, as developed brands frequently include a costs price because of their track record for quality and service. Recognizing these factors can help home owners make informed choices regarding their garage door replacement.

Product Options and Their Prices
Exploring product choices is a crucial action in determining the total price of a garage door replacement (Commercial Garage Door Replacement in Casa Grande). The option of material not just affects the aesthetic appeal of the door yet likewise considerably affects sturdiness, upkeep, and the preliminary acquisition price
Usual products include steel, timber, light weight aluminum, fiberglass, and plastic, each with unique attributes and cost points. Steel doors are typically the most cost-effective, with costs varying from $700 to $2,500 depending upon insulation and design attributes. Timber doors offer natural appeal and personalization but usually range from $1,200 to $4,000, requiring more maintenance due to susceptibility to bending and climate damages.
Aluminum doors are resistant and lightweight to rust, generally valued between $800 and $2,500. Fiberglass doors offer exceptional insulation and can mimic the look of wood, costing between $1,000 and $3,500. Plastic doors, known for their toughness and reduced upkeep, variety from $800 to $2,000.
Eventually, comprehending the cost ramifications of each material choice is necessary for making an informed decision that straightens with both budget plan and lasting expectations.
Long-Term Financial Effects
Selecting the right material for a garage door not only influences first expenses yet likewise lugs substantial lasting economic implications. Various materials, such as wood, steel, and fiberglass, use varying longevity, upkeep requirements, and power effectiveness. For circumstances, steel doors might involve a higher ahead of time price, however their durability can bring about reduced repair service and replacement costs with time. Alternatively, wood doors might need constant maintenance, possibly rising long-lasting expenses.
Energy effectiveness is another important aspect. Insulated doors can lower home heating and air conditioning expenses, converting to financial savings on utility bills. Buying a premium, insulated garage door may cause a higher initial investment, but the repayment through energy cost savings is often understood within a few years.
In addition, the long-lasting worth of the home can be impacted. A well-kept, visually pleasing garage door boosts visual charm, which can result in enhanced anonymous property worth. Home owners ought to likewise consider service warranty terms, as longer warranties can mitigate future repair service costs.
